I have configured a switch with SNMP to get IN and OUT traffic port by port, so i have a RRD file with IN and OUT for each switch port (in this case 48 ports = 48 RRD files). Well, all this works OK.,.... but what i need is to see all the traffic of the VLANs. I explain...... I have one VLAN called VLAN1 with the ports 6,7,8,9,10 and 11, so i want to create a RRD file with the traffic of that VLAN, the sum of the traffic of ports 6,7,8,9,10 and 10. An example: traffic (in bytes): port 6 = 100 port 7 = 200 port 8 = 50 port 9 = 300 port 10 = 50 port 11 = 100 VLAN1 = 800 How can i create (automatically or via perl script) a RRD file with the VLAN1 traffic???
